Buyer’s Guide: What to Consider
Choosing the right downpipe flange depends on your exhaust setup, material preference, and how you plan to connect it. Here are five key factors to consider before making a purchase.
- Exhaust Tubing Size: Match the flange port diameter to your exhaust tubing. The 3.5-inch options fit 3.50-inch OD tubing, while the V-band flange uses 3.00-inch tubing. Using the correct size ensures a leak-free weld and optimal flow.
- Material Choice: Steel flanges are durable and cost-effective, but stainless steel (304L) offers superior corrosion resistance and longevity, especially in harsh environments. Consider your budget and how long you plan to keep the vehicle.
- Connection Type: Bolt-on flanges are traditional and secure, while V-band connections allow for quicker removal and installation. Think about how often you need to access the turbo or exhaust system for maintenance.
- Wastegate Integration: All three flanges feature an internal wastegate port, which simplifies routing and reduces exhaust leaks. This design is ideal for keeping the wastegate flow contained within the downpipe.
- Thickness and Rigidity: A 1/2-inch thick flange resists warping under high heat, ensuring a stable seal. This is especially important for high-boost applications where thermal expansion can cause issues.
